Can you use any door as a pocket door?

In the realm of interior design, pocket doors have gained popularity for their sleek and space-saving design. These doors slide into a wall cavity, making them an excellent choice for rooms with limited space or where traditional swing doors would be impractical. However, many homeowners wonder if any door can be converted into a pocket door. In this article, we will explore the factors to consider when deciding whether a door can be used as a pocket door.

Understanding Pocket Doors

First, let’s clarify what a pocket door is. A pocket door is a type of sliding door that is designed to slide into a wall cavity, rather than swinging open into the room. This design allows for more space-efficient use of the room, as the door does not require additional space to open. Pocket doors are typically used in narrow hallways, bathrooms, or as room dividers.

Factors to Consider

When determining if a door can be used as a pocket door, several factors must be considered:

1. Door Size: The door must be the correct size to fit into the wall cavity. This typically means the door should be slightly narrower than the cavity to ensure it slides smoothly.

2. Wall Thickness: The wall must be thick enough to accommodate the pocket door system. Most pocket door systems require a minimum wall thickness of 5.5 inches.

3. Door Material: The material of the door can affect its suitability for a pocket door conversion. Solid wood doors, for example, are more suitable than hollow-core doors, as they are more durable and less likely to warp.

4. Door Hardware: The hardware used for the pocket door system must be compatible with the door and wall. This includes the track, roller, and mounting hardware.

5. Professional Installation: While it is possible to install a pocket door as a DIY project, it is recommended to hire a professional installer to ensure the door operates smoothly and safely.
